三种基质下不同丛枝菌根真菌对卡里佐枳橙容器苗生长及氮磷含量影响的研究
Influence of Different AMF on Growth and Content of Nitrogen and Phosphorus of Container Seedlings of Carrizo Citrange in Three Substrates

中文摘要:
      为了探索AM真菌在柑桔砧木容器苗生产的合理应用,更好地利用其优势AM真菌菌种资源,培育出优良的柑桔砧木菌根化容器苗,本试验采用盆栽方法,以未接种AM真菌的植株为对照,研究了7种丛枝菌根真菌在三种基质下对卡里佐枳橙容器苗生长及氮磷含量的影响。结果表明:AM真菌接种剂对卡里佐丛枝菌根的形成均有显著影响,但是各处理影响作用差异很大;在7种丛枝菌根真菌处理中,GM和GV混合接种对卡里佐幼苗的生长、菌根侵染率和氮磷含量促进作用最强;在备选的3种基质中,腐叶土对幼苗的生长、菌根侵染率及含氮量促进作用最强。因此以GM和GV混合接种,并采用腐叶土的容器基质组合为最佳。
英文摘要:
      In order to make use of dominant species of AMF on container seedlings of citrus rootstocks production, and cultivate high quality mycorrhizal fungi container seedlings of citrus rootstocks, with potted experiment in a greenhouse,the experiment was carried out to investigate the effects of sever arbuscular mycorrhiza inoculated in three substrates on the growth and content of Nitrogen and Phosphorus in container seedlings of Carrizo Citrange comparing to control group of non-inoculated seedlings .The results showed that all test AMF could form mycorrhiza with Carrizo Citrange seedings,but the difference of various trentments was significant.Amoung seven AM fungi trentments, Glomus mosseae mixed Glomus versiforme gave the best results in accelerating the growth of seedlings,increasing colonization rate and improving the content of N and P;Amoung three substrates, rotten leaves also gave the best results. So, it was optimal that Carrizo seedlings inoculated with Gm Gv were cultivated in substrates for rotten leaves: garden mould: sand (2:1:1).
